Supplementary Instructions: Twin Drive CD Recorders
6030 and 6031 supplement
SELECTING DRIVES
Which drive should I use?
You can use either CD drive for playing, recording or copying.
For simplicity, these instructions show copying from Drive A (left)
to Drive B (right).
Using the A/B key
The keypad controls whichever drive has been selected
with the A/B key. Press it to switch between drives.
The selected drive appears in the
top left hand of the LCD screen
just below the CD icon.
COPYING CDs
Inserting CDs into different drives
On start-up, CD drive A is automatically selected. Insert the
master disc, then select drive B to insert a blank CD/R or RW.
Copying an entire CD
Important note: you can only copy entire CDs onto a blank CD!
Press the MENU key and select Copy functions > Copy disc.
Follow the
instructions shown
on the LCD screen.
When copy is selected a new screen provides information.
Copying occurs
at high speed.
You may notice a
slight increase in
noise from both CD
drives as copying
takes place.
When copying is complete the LCD will display information
about the newly copied disc.

Repeat options
Programme
Select tracks for playing in the order of your choice.
Intro
Select to play the first 5 seconds of each track, allowing
you to listen to and select a track of your choice.
Upon hearing the desired track, press the PLAY key.
Intro mode is cancelled and the track will continue to play.
Random
Select to play all of the tracks in a random order.
